Output 1654456914caf2e666d2ce86170b805d86391d9d317d637a5550e728b2676013:15

value
853420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ec0167d74d4390b2688d40dfd1bdad9e9132a7e OP_EQUAL
address
3EhozHHYdwDcneqPTiVqCVDdNy6FA2wa3q
transaction
1654456914caf2e666d2ce86170b805d86391d9d317d637a5550e728b2676013
spent
true